The ABC Movie of the Week: Big Movies for the Small Screen
Michael McKenna
This book looks at the cultural impact of the ABC Movie of the Week, the first weekly movies series made for television, which began in 1969 and ran for six years. Films that debuted on the program include Brian's Song, That Certain Summer, The Night Stalker, Trilogy of Terror, Go Ask Alice, The Six Million Dollar Man, and Don't Be Afraid of the Dark (remade as a 2011 feature film).
